The Challenges of Full SEO Automation
Despite its appeal, fully automated SEO has limits. Understanding them helps you set realistic expectations before adopting any SEO automation software.
-
Context and Creativity
– AI can analyse keywords and metadata, yet it struggles with nuanced storytelling and audience-specific tone.
– Risk: Cookie-cutter content that feels generic. -
Quality Assurance
– Automated link audits might flag broken URLs but can miss relevancy or brand fit.
– Risk: Blind spots in user experience and editorial standards. -
Algorithm Changes
– Google updates can de-prioritise tactics overnight.
– While some AI tools learn in real time, many rely on historical data, leading to delayed responses. -
Integration Complexity
– Legacy systems often don’t sync smoothly with new platforms.
– Smooth data flow is essential for any high-grade SEO automation software to deliver on promise.
By acknowledging these gaps, you can build a mixed approach: combine AI-led efficiency with human checks and balances.
